Output 8d9a0364be5f28b7603431b0673f5d02c5958b94f6fb98a437edc7019d26860c:14

value
32054731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e0a5ce0ee2843992cc3a34fdcfdc7d97038607a OP_EQUAL
address
37M4ETVyGzhwn51KWo4d78RwchBz5k1c7p
transaction
8d9a0364be5f28b7603431b0673f5d02c5958b94f6fb98a437edc7019d26860c
spent
true